## Deployment

Search relevance tuning for Findery ships with the ranker service, not separately. Edit weights only via the tuning notes file; direct index changes get overwritten nightly. Deploy with the standard pipeline; canary runs 30 minutes against replayed queries before promotion. Rollback is one command. On boot the ranker loads the following configuration values.

service settings:
[druius]
team = wenael
access_code = ac_8a6f89
owner = keleth.briius
host = druius.nelvrocorp.example
port = 3306
peer = tamix.tolvaqforge.example
salt = 97259282
pin = 0863

QUARTERLY PLANNING NOTE — Marketing Budget

Branch managers: quick heads-up before the numbers land. Central marketing spend drops 18% next quarter, mostly out of regional print and the Harlowe sponsorship. Local event budgets survive, barely. Please don't promise vendors anything until allocations are final. The thinking behind the cut — keep it to yourselves — is set out below.

board note of kageg-bahof: The renewal with Holwynax Holdings closes at $2 million a year, 5 percent below the last contract. Project Ulaath slips by two quarters because of the supplier delay.

Facilities ticket — Night shift, Brindlecote Campus. Twenty-two interns from the Fennhollow programme arrive tomorrow at 08:00. Please unlock seminar rooms B2 and B3 by 06:30, set chairs to classroom layout, and confirm the water coolers on level one are refilled. Leave the loading bay clear for their equipment van. Overnight access to the prep corridor requires the pass code below.

badge for bajop-yawep: bdg-NNHEW-6

Notice — Visiting Contractors, Brantholm House. Reception has moved to the ground floor, east entrance off Mill Court. The level 1 desk is closed. Sign in at the new desk, collect your day pass, and wait for your escort. Deliveries still go via the rear dock. The ground-floor door accepts the contractor code below.

staff pass of kawip-hawef = bdg-QLP-2